Do not force GM20b GPCPLL post divider to 1:2 settings before switching
to bypass clock if PLL output frequency is increased as a result. Move
this step under bypass. However, this step is still needed in case when
PLL can be configured without switch to bypass.

The code took reference to gk20a by using gk20a_busy_noresume(). This
function takes pm runtime reference only to the GPU, however, the code
dropped the reference by calling gk20a_idle() which also drops the
reference to the platform dependencies (host1x).
This patch modifies gm20b_mm_mmu_vpr_info_fetch_wait() to drop only
the GPU reference.

Updated GM20B GPCPLL programming sequence to utilize new glitch-less
post divider:
- No longer bypass PLL for re-locking if it is already enabled, and
post divider as well as feedback divider are changing (input divider
change is still under bypass only).
- Use post divider instead of external linear divider to introduce
(VCO min/2) intermediated step when changing PLL frequency.

Updated GPCPLL parameters according to GM20b specification.
Modified PLL programming, since on GM20b PLL post divider value is
equal to divider setting (which was not the case on GK20a this code
was inherited from).

For GM20B alone, the LTC count is already accounted for the HW logic
for the CBC base calculation from the postDivide address. So SW
doesn't have to explicity divide it by the LTC count in the postDivide
address calculation.
